Earlier this month, we’ve seen the rough sketch of the new Opel Meriva Minivan Concept that will make its debut at the 2008 Geneva Motor Show. Opel has released another teaser and details of the Meriva Concept.
The Meriva Minivan Concept is expected to be on production sometime in 2009. The Meriva features rear-hinged rear doors on both sides of the car called FlexDoors. The rear doors swing open towards the back of the car, while the front doors are conventionally designed with front hinges.
Another feature Meriva Concept is that the front and rear doors can open independently of each other because the existing rear-hinged rear doors on the market can only be opened after the front door has been opened, which is not that practical for a family-oriented vehicle.
